Overview

The Engineering & Maintenance Manager will administer and coordinate the affairs of all disciplines of the department, including Mechanical Maintenance, Instrument/Electrical Maintenance, Reliability, and Project Engineering to achieve overall departmental and corporate goals.

Responsibilities
  • Keep safe work habits as the highest priority at all times.
  • Maintain a clean and well‑organized workspace.
  • Develop strong working relationships with coworkers, customers, and associates.
  • Ensure department training and safety needs are identified and met.
  • Identify any safety, quality, or environmental issues and define solutions using the Corrective and Preventive Action Program.
  • Support facility and individual departments in the development and implementation of operating budgets (capital and expense), including project proposals, budget estimates, and updates for annual and quarterly budget reviews.
  • Develop, implement, and maintain programs to keep project costs to a minimum while maximizing safety, reliability, and efficiency.
  • Actively involve employees in the continual development, maintenance, and improvement of maintenance/engineering policies, procedures, design specifications, and business systems.
  • Evaluate maintenance/engineering staffing requirements to meet facility/department goals and make recommendations for staffing changes to the Plant Manager.
  • Secure, coordinate, and supervise contract consulting, engineering, design, and vendor services for supplemental design assistance as needed.
  • Strive to continually improve all aspects of the Maintenance/Engineering Department to create a better work environment for employees.
  • Lead the Maintenance/Engineering Department in scoping, planning, scheduling, and coordination of all project‑related activities utilizing all applicable work groups and resources for efficient completion of tasks.
  • Conduct regular department group meetings to discuss current and completed activities, share lessons learned, and determine upcoming project activity priorities.
  • Work with department employees to balance resources for construction‑related activities and take advantage of manpower efficiency opportunities.
  • Lead the Maintenance/Engineering Department in all phases of project development, preparation, and implementation.
  • Monitor the progress of all project phases to verify accuracy of schedule and budget estimates.
  • Lead the preparation of detailed project estimates/cost justifications and the development of Authorization for Expenditure (AFE’s) and other documentation for management approval of project‑related activities.
  • Organize, prepare, and conduct project review and update meetings with key personnel to further develop and review project details.
  • Ensure the documentation of all phases of project design, construction, and installation to verify compliance with Ergon specifications and standards, applicable design and construction codes, and industry recommended practices.
  • Initiate, participate in, and ensure the completion of Management of Change (MOC) procedures, including Pre‑Startup Safety Reviews (PSSR) for project‑related activities.
  • Participate in all aspects of miscellaneous projects as necessary to meet the needs of the department.
  • Actively involve employees in all business systems development, maintenance, and improvement.
  • Participate in periodic management reviews of the quality system.
  • Manage both daily maintenance and turnaround planning/scheduling activities.
  • Identify, monitor, and report key performance indicators (KPIs) for maintenance/engineering.
  • Monitor accuracy of cost allocations to orders and purchase orders.
  • Monitor parts warehouse inventory and approve new stock requests.
  • Assist sister plants as needed with maintenance, project engineering, AFEs, and related activities.
Qualifications
  • B.S. in Mechanical, Chemical, or Civil Engineering.
  • Five years minimum experience in a maintenance/engineering environment.
  • Experience in a chemical processing or refining environment preferred.
  • Self‑motivated with strong leadership, communication, and organization skills.
  • Experience with Microsoft Windows, Microsoft Project, Excel, and Word.
  • Knowledge of SAP maintenance management system is ideal.
  • Demonstrated experience developing, implementing, and managing preventative, predictive, and risk‑based maintenance programs as part of an Asset Reliability Culture.
  • Knowledge of OSHA Process Safety Management Elements is ideal.
  • Experience managing a diverse team of employees.
  • Demonstrates values of Integrity, Performance, Teamwork, Courage, and Learning.
  • Strong experience in strategic and tactical planning and implementation.
  • Potential and desire for growth into Operations.
